The Position
Custodial Workers perform general cleaning services to State facilities using various cleaning equipment and materials to provide a safe, hygienic and orderly work environment.
The Custodial Worker 2 position at the Nevada National Guard Reno location is responsible for maintaining the cleanliness, safety, and general upkeep of buildings and surrounding grounds. Working under the direction of a Custodial Supervisor, this role follows established procedures and safety guidelines to ensure facilities remain orderly and fully operational. Key responsibilities include cleaning and sanitizing restrooms, locker rooms, and common areas; vacuuming, sweeping, and mopping floors; dusting surfaces; emptying trash and recycling; and restocking restroom and cleaning supplies. The position also reports maintenance or safety concerns, performs routine scheduled cleaning tasks, and assists with event setups or special projects as needed.***THIS RECRUITMENT MAY CLOSE WITHOUT FURTHER NOTICE DEPENDING ON THE NUMBER OF APPLICATIONS RECEIVED. To Qualify:
In order to be qualified, you must meet the following requirements:
Education and Experience (Minimum Qualifications)

Graduation from high school or equivalent education and one year of custodial or janitorial experience in a commercial, industrial, hospital, governmental or similar environment; OR six months of general work experience and one year of custodial or janitorial experience in a commercial, industrial, hospital, governmental or similar environment; OR six months of experience as a Custodial Worker I in Nevada State service;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ience as described above.

Special Notes

Incumbents may be required to work extended hours, weekends, and holidays in addition to their normal work schedules.

Special Requirements

A State of Nevada/FBI background check will be required of the selected applicant.

This position requires the 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ds.

A valid driver's license or evidence of equivalent mobility is required at the time of appointment and as a condition of continuing employment.

Additional Position Criteria

This position requires a valid Real ID at the time of appointment and for continuing employment.
